What the Data Says About Sora

The Social Security Administration has registered 1,699 babies named Sora between 1972 and 2024, spanning 53 consecutive years of U.S. birth records. As a girl's name, Sora currently holds the #1966 rank among girls for 2024. The name reached its historical peak in 2023, when 108 babies received it in a single year. Sora is classified as unisex in SSA records: the opposite-sex variant accounts for 600 additional births since 2004.

Decade-level aggregation shows that Sora performed strongest in the 2010s, accumulating 601 births during that ten-year window. Across the 6 decades of recorded activity, Sora shows a stable profile with only moderate drift from its peak decade. Geographically, the name is most concentrated in New York, which accounts for 197 births — the largest state-level total in the dataset — followed by California and New Jersey. In total, SSA state-level files list Sora in 14 of the 51 U.S. reporting jurisdictions.

These figures derive from SSA's annual national and state-level name files, which include any name appearing at least five times in a given year or state-year; names below that threshold are suppressed for privacy and therefore excluded from the totals shown here. The 1,699 total represents a lower bound — actual usage may be higher in years or states where the count fell below the disclosure floor.
